WHO are these diverse students in Alberta schools?
![Page 7: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/7.jpg)
In an Alberta school of 500 students,
we might expect to see…
![Page 8: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/8.jpg)
•25 students
with learning disabilities
•40 students
with AD/HD
![Page 9: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
•45 students who live
below the poverty line
•40 students whose
first language is not English or French
•25 students who
are First Nations, Métis or Inuit (FNMI)
![Page 10: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
• 7 students
with autism
• 5 students
with FASD
![Page 11: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
• At least 1 student
with a physical disability
• 15 students with cognitive disabilities
![Page 12: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
• 8 students with severe behavioural/emotional disabilities
• 7 students requiring support for mental health issues
![Page 13: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/13.jpg)
• 100 students who will not finish high school within 5 years

Why consider a wider range of students?
• Current special education categories describe less
than 10% of learners
• There is not a common understanding of these
categories across the province: <50% in 2008
• Medical diagnoses do not necessarily provide
implications for learning and instruction

Diversity and Collaboration:
The case of bees
35°C = optimal temperature for bee hives
2 behaviours:
Too hot: fan out or leaveToo cold: get closer
![Page 25: Student Diversity in Alberta: Inclusion for all. “An inclusive education system is one that takes responsibility for all students, focuses on their strengths,](https://reader030.vdocuments.site/reader030/viewer/2022032804/56649e425503460f94b34817/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
How diversity helpsGenetically homogeneous bees: All
get cold (or hot) at the same time.
Genetically diverse bees: Get cold (or hot) at different temperatures. Temperature stabilizes.

Rosado’s Four Imperatives for effectively managing diversity (adapted for education)
1) Reflect the heterogeneity of the community (affirmative action)
2) Be sensitive to the needs of the various groups (value differences)
3) Incorporate a range of contributions to the overall mission of education (managing diversity)
4) Create cultural and social ambiance that is
inclusive and empowers all groups (living diversity)
Rosado, 2006
